Latvia - Spelt and Wheat Harvested Production

Since 2015, Latvia Spelt and Wheat Harvested Production rose 3.4% year on year. With 2,659.6 Thousand Metric Tons in 2020, the country was number 16 among other countries in Spelt and Wheat Harvested Production. Latvia is overtaken by Serbia, which was ranked number 15 with 2,873.5 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Slovakia at 2,136.77 Thousand Metric Tons. France ranked the highest with 30,072.84 Thousand Metric Tons in 2020, -25.9% compared to 2019. Germany, Turkey and Poland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bosnia and Herzegovina recorded the best 5 years average growth at +8.6% per year, while Ireland witnessed the worst performance at -11.2% per year.
